Android ir “Open” un iOS ir “Closed” - bet ko tas nozīmē jums?
Ja kaut kas, šķiet, ir vienisprātis, tas ir, ka Google Android ir vairāk atvērts, un Apple iOS ir „slēgtāka” operētājsistēma. Lūk, ko tas jums nozīmē.
„Atvērt” pret “slēgta” nozīmē daudzas lietas, sākot ar pirmkodu līdz lietojumprogrammu veikalam, līdz operētājsistēmai varat pielāgot un izmainīt lietas.
Open-Source (daļēji) pret slēgtu avotu
Android ir “atvērts” dažādos veidos. Pirmkārt, Android operētājsistēma ir balstīta uz kodu no “Android Open Source Project” vai AOSP. Tas ir atvērts pirmkods, lai cilvēki varētu izmantot šo pirmkodu un no tā izveidot individuālas operētājsistēmas. CyanogenMod ir, piemēram, pielāgots ROM, kas balstīts uz šo kodu. Amazon's Fire OS, kas tiek izmantots iekurt ugunsgrēka un ugunsdzēsības tālrunī, ir balstīts arī uz šo atvērtā pirmkoda Android kodu.
Tomēr arvien vairāk un vairāk Android ir slēgtas avota lietojumprogrammas un API no Google Play pakalpojumiem. “Android” var nozīmēt vairākas lietas. Tā ir atvērtā koda operētājsistēma (AOSP), jā. Bet to, ko lielākā daļa cilvēku domā kā “Android”, kas ir pilnīgs ar visiem Google bitiem, ir tikai daļēji atvērta pirmkoda operētājsistēma. Un lielākā daļa tālruņu ir aprīkoti ar bloķētu bootloader - daži, iespējams, neļauj to atbloķēt, neizmantojot drošības ievainojamību, tāpēc jūsu vēlamās Android OS instalēšana var būt sarežģītāka, nekā jūs domājat.
No otras puses, Apple iOS ir slēgts avots. Jā, tai ir daži atvērtā koda biti, bet lielākā daļa operētājsistēmas ir slēgts avots. Nav reālas iespējas izveidot jaunu operētājsistēmu.
Ko tas nozīmē jums: Ja izmisīgi vēlaties, lai savam tālrunim būtu pielāgoti ROM, un vēlaties izjaukt ar šādu lietu, Android ir jums. Ja tā nav, iOS ir labi. Un šeit ir žēl patiesība: viens no lielākajiem iemesliem, kāpēc instalēt pielāgotu ROM, ir iegūt modernāku Android versiju tālrunī, kuru ražotājs vairs neatbalsta. Tas nav problēma ar iOS.
Lietojumprogrammas var nākt no jebkuras vietas pret tikai App Store
Android ierīcē varat pārslēgt slēdzi, lai instalētu lietotnes no „nezināmiem avotiem”. Tas ļauj instalēt lietojumprogrammas ārpus Google Play, kas ir Google lietotņu veikals. Pat ja Google neapstiprina lietotni, to var instalēt no citām valstīm. Google ir arī mazāk ierobežojoša attiecībā uz lietotnēm savā lietotņu veikalā.
IOS var instalēt programmas tikai no Apple App Store. Ja Apple nevēlas apstiprināt lietotni vai tās noņem no lietotņu veikala, jūs to vienkārši nevarat izmantot. Nepietiekamām lietojumprogrammām “Sideloading” ir nepieciešama iznīcināšana, kas ir galvassāpes.
Ko tas nozīmē jums: Atkarībā no tā, ko vēlaties darīt savā tālrunī, tas var būt aktuāls jautājums. Piemēram, Apple lietotņu veikals nepieļauj videospēļu emulatorus, BitTorrent klientus un cita veida lietojumprogrammas, ko tās uzskata par pretrunīgām. Piemēram, Apple aizliedz spēles ar pretrunīgu saturu no lietotņu veikala.
Reāli, lielākā daļa cilvēku, iespējams, nesasniegs šos ierobežojumus. Bet, ja jūs plānojat izmantot videospēļu emulatorus un cita veida pretrunīgas lietojumprogrammas, jūs, iespējams, vēlaties saņemt Android tālruni iPhone vietā.
Pielāgojamība un elastība
Vēsturiski Android tālruņi ir bijuši elastīgāki. Android lietotnēm ir piekļuve visai failu sistēmai, var sazināties viena ar otru, izmantojot funkciju Share, mainīt sākuma ekrāna palaidēju, nomainīt tastatūru, iestatīt sevi kā noklusējuma lietotnes un veikt daudzas citas lietas. Piemēram, dažas lietotnes faktiski var pārspēt citu lietotņu virsotni. Logrīkus var ievietot visu sākuma ekrānu. Varat instalēt trešās puses palaišanas programmu un ikonu tēmu, lai pilnībā mainītu sākumekrāna un lietotnes ikonas.
iOS ir ierobežotāks. Lietojumprogrammām nav tik daudz jaudas, kas tām ir pieejama, un tām nav atļauts sazināties. Gadu gaitā Apple ir uzlabojusies. Lietojumprogrammas fonā var darīt vairāk, un iOS 8 pievieno koplietošanas funkciju, trešo pušu tastatūras un logrīkus, kas darbojas paziņošanas centrā, nevis sākuma ekrānā.
Ko tas nozīmē jums: iOS ir vēl ierobežotāks, bet iOS ir pieejamas tādas funkcijas kā logrīki, koplietošana starp lietotnēm, fonā darbojošām lietotnēm un trešo pušu tastatūras. Ja vēlaties izveidot visu sākuma ekrānu un bloķēšanas ekrānu citā veidā, jums būs nepieciešams Android tālrunis. Bet iOS piedāvā daudz elastības, nepārvietojoties pilnīgi pāri bortam.
Tomēr Apple iOS joprojām neļauj jums izvēlēties noklusējuma tīmekļa pārlūkprogrammu, e-pasta klientu, kartēšanas lietotni un citas noklusējuma lietotnes - tas joprojām ir nedaudz kaitinošas, ja vēlaties citas lietotnes.
Sakņošanās pret Jailbreaking
Neskatoties uz visiem Android piedāvājumiem, daudzas funkcijas ir bloķētas aiz “sakņu”. Jums būs nepieciešama root piekļuve, lai patiešām izmantotu visas Android Android entuziastu trompetes. Vairumā tālruņu iesakņošana faktiski prasa drošības ievainojamības izmantošanu. Dažos tālruņos, piemēram, Google Nexus tālruņos, ir viegli apiet drošību un darīt to, ko vēlaties. Taču Google joprojām nevēlas iesakņoties, un Android atjauninājumi noņems jūsu saknes piekļuvi.
Apple lietotājiem, kuri vēlas lietot neapstiprinātas lietotnes, tweaks un padziļinātu piekļuvi iOS, operētājsistēmai ir jābūt “jailbreak”. Tas faktiski ir līdzīgs sakņošanai dažos veidos - tam ir nepieciešams izmantot drošības caurumu iOS. Kad esat veicis jailbreak, jūs ne vienmēr varat jaunināt uz jaunu iOS versiju. Jums vispirms būs jāgaida jailbreak, lai to atbrīvotu, vai arī jūs zaudēsiet visus jūsu jailbreak tweaks.
Ko tas nozīmē jums: Tas parasti ir vieglāk root Android nekā jailbreak iOS. Pārliecinieties, lai izvēlētos tālruni, kas ir viegli sakņojams, ja tas jums ir svarīgi.
Tātad galu galā, kas tas ir svarīgi? Lielākajai daļai cilvēku tas godīgi nav svarīgi. iOS piedāvā arvien lielāku elastību ar katru versiju. Google Android nav pilnīgi atvērta platforma - kaut ko pilnīgi atvērtam avotam, iespējams, vēlēsities apskatīt Ubuntu tālruņiem vai Firefox OS.
No otras puses, ja jūs esat kāds, kurš vēlas pielāgot katru mazo lietu par ierīci, izmainīt zemu līmeni, un nejaušo lietotņu instalēšana, Apple var neapstiprināt, Android tālrunis joprojām ir elastīgāka platforma šim nolūkam.
Tas nav iespējams aptvert visus šīs diskusijas aspektus vienā amatā, bet tas dod jums priekšstatu par to, kas šeit ir „atvērts” un “slēgts”. Gadu gaitā Android un iOS ir kļuvušas tuvākas viena otrai, jo Google visa Android platforma kļūst mazāk atvērta, jo Google Play pakalpojumos tiek iekļautas vairākas lietas, un iOS piedāvā lielāku jaudu un elastību lietotnēm un lietotājiem.
Image Credit: Aidan par Flickr